A realistic 2026 Hawaii trip: a couple from Los Angeles to Honolulu for 7 nights in a Waikiki condo ($205/night plus the 13.25% lodging tax), a car at $60/day, food at $78/person/day and one luau for two ($300) — round-trip airfare $1030 at the midpoint of the $380–650/person band — lands at roughly $4467.1375 total, $2233.56875 per person (between $4197.1375 and $4737.1375 depending on fare season). The same week in a full resort hotel with resort fees ($45/night) climbs to about $6209.0875. Oahu is the one island where the car is optional; on Maui, Big Island and Kauai it is near-essential. Adding a second island costs $90–140 per person.

Interisland hops (Hawaiian/Southwest, ~45 min) run roughly $90–140 round trip per person booked 2+ weeks out; same-week bookings can hit $200+.
Condo: $205/night + 13.25% lodging tax, kitchen trims the food bill
Oahu is the one island where a car is optional: Waikiki is walkable, TheBus (#20/19 from the airport) covers the island, and tours shuttle you to Pearl Harbor and the North Shore.
The 13.25% lodging tax and resort fees are added automatically; the fare band is $380–$650/person from LAX. 2026 norms, approximate — prices swing by season.
